H3>Home Remedies for Eye Pressure Relief Many effective home remedies can help reduce eye pressure. One of the simplest methods is using a cool compress for your eyes. The coolness relaxes the muscles around your eyes, providing immediate relief. Simply soak a clean cloth in cold water, wring it out, and place it over your closed eyelids for about 10 to 15 minutes. In addition, considering eye massages could provide substantial relief. By gently massaging the area around your eyes, you improve blood circulation, which can help ease discomfort. Essential oils, like lavender or chamomile, can enhance the calming experience. For those interested in herbal remedies, drinking herbal teas designed for eye health, such as chamomile or green tea, can be soothing and provide antioxidant benefits that support overall eye wellness. H3>Practicing Eye Exercises for Relaxation Engaging in eye exercises can be a powerful way to relieve eye pressure and prevent strain. One effective technique to incorporate into your routine is the 20-20-20 rule: every 20 minutes, take a 20-second break and focus on something 20 feet away. This simple strategy allows your eye muscles to relax, significantly decreasing tension that develops from continuous screen time. Additional eye exercises for relaxation can include rolling your eyes, blinking frequently, and adjusting your focus from near to far. Implementing these exercises regularly throughout your day not only improves comfort but also promotes better visual health in the long run.

Adjusting Screen Brightness for Comfort

Improper screen brightness can contribute significantly to eye strain. Ensure your screen brightness is matched to the surrounding lighting conditions. If your workspace is brightly lit, consider increasing your screen brightness. Conversely, in dimmer surroundings, reduce your screen brightness to avoid glare and stress on the eyes. Using blue light filters can further protect your eyes from potential strain caused by prolonged screen use. These filters can easily be installed on devices or you can opt for anti-reflective glasses designed for screen use. H3>Maintaining Proper Distance from Screens Another critical aspect of managing eye strain is keeping a proper distance from your screens. Ensure that your computer monitor or digital devices are at least an arm's length away from your eyes. Additionally, the top of your screen should ideally be at or slightly below eye level to minimize strain on your neck and eyes. Adjusting your chair height accordingly can enhance comfort, reducing the need to lean forward or squint. This alignment not only prolongs screen comfort but also promotes a more ergonomic approach to daily tasks. H3>Implementing Regular Breaks Incorporating regular breaks into your screen time routine is essential for eye relaxation. Beyond the 20-20-20 rule, consider using timers to remind you when to take breaks. During these breaks, it’s crucial to engage in activities that do not involve screens, such as stretching, walking, or simply resting your eyes by closing them for a few moments. These brief intermissions can significantly reduce eye fatigue and help you maintain better focus and productivity throughout your tasks. Benefits of Regular Eye Check-ups

Regular eye check-ups are crucial for proactively managing eye pressure. These visits not only allow for monitoring of your eye health but also offer an opportunity to discuss any concerns or symptoms you may be experiencing with your eye care provider. Establishing a timeline for check-ups—typically once every one to two years for most adults—ensures that any potential issues are caught early. During these appointments, eye specialists can evaluate pressures, screen for eye diseases, and even provide personalized tips on managing discomfort based on individual lifestyles and habits.
